Leatherman Wire Cutters Compared

Joe shows the superiority of the older Leatherman replaceable wire cutters in a demonstration using common coat hanger wire. The new style replaceable cutters, which Leatherman expects customers to buy and replace themselves upon breaking, are vastly inferior to the previous iteration and are looking more like a cash grab than a value add for their customers.
